Abstract

A system for intercepting targets having predictable flight trajectory, the system comprising a platform carrying an interceptor missile which includes a seeker unit, propulsion system steering system and destruction capability system, all communicating with a processor device. The processor device is further coupled to a data link for communicating with the platform. In response to launching of the intercepting missile, the processor device controls the steering system and propulsion system for steering the missile in one of the following flight modes: (a) approach mode, wherein said intercepting missile closes on said target; (b) trajectory matching mode wherein the interceptor velocity vector is modified to bring the trajectory of the interceptor to match the predicted trajectory of the target so that the interceptor moves in the same direction as the target in a relatively small closing velocity with respect to the target; and (c) end game mode wherein the interceptor is maneuvered to a distance sufficiently close to the target whereby the target destruction capability can be activated efficiently.
